Jona Lewie (born John Lewis; 14 March 1947) is an English singer-songwriter and multi-instrumentalist, best known for his 1980 UK hits "You'll Always Find Me in the Kitchen at Parties" and "Stop the Cavalry". == Career == === Early career === Jona Lewie joined his first group, the Johnston City Jazz Band, while still at school in 1963, and by 1968 had become a blues and boogie singer and piano player. As a songwriter, Jona Lewie first charted in 1972 with Seaside Shuffle.The artist scored 4 UK Top‑75 entries, including a single Top‑10 placement.
